This years has been a truly international year for the Botany Department - the lichen research group, lead by Associate Curator and Botany Chair Thorsten Lumbsch and Collections Manager and Adjunct Curator Robert Luecking alone had visitors from all continents (except Antarctica) visiting the museum to work with their research group.
Thorsten Lumbsch and Robert Luecking are working on a collaborative project with about 50 colleagues worldwide funded by the National Science Foundation.
